Navigating the extensive world of medications can be confusing, especially when distinguishing between prescription and over-the-counter (OTC) options. Prescription drugs, as the label suggests, require a authorization from a licensed healthcare professional. These medications are often used to manage severe health issues and may have potential side effects. OTC medications, on the other hand, are readily obtainable without a formal request. They are generally used for frequent ailments like headaches, aches, and allergies. Consulting a pharmacist or your doctor can be advantageous in making informed selections about which type of medication is most fitting for your needs.

Decoding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ients: The Building Blocks of Drugs
Pharmaceutical ingredients are the heart of any drug. These molecules, often referred to as active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s), are liable for the specific therapeutic result in a patient. Understanding these key elements is vital for creating safe and effective medications.
The complexity of APIs can vary greatly, ranging from simple organic molecules to complex antibodies. The characteristics of an API affect its absorption within the body and ultimately its potency in treating a specific ailment.
Pharmacologists constantly strive to identify new APIs with improved tolerability and therapeutic benefits. This ongoing investigation is essential for progressing novel treatments for a wide range of ailments.
Tackling Prescription Drug Costs and Alternatives
The skyrocketing costs of prescription medications can be a significant burden for many individuals. Luckily, there are various strategies you can utilize to reduce these expenses and gain access to affordable treatments. Initially investigating generic drug options, which are often much less expensive than their brand-name counterparts while offering the same active ingredients. Another valuable step is discussing your physician about potential cost-saving programs offered by pharmaceutical Medication safety information companies or insurance providers. Additionally, consider utilizing prescription drug discount cards or membership programs that can negotiate lower prices on medications.
- Additionally, contrast prices at different pharmacies to discover the most affordable options.
- Bear in mind that your health is a major focus. Don't hesitate to talk about any concerns you have about medication costs with your doctor, who can suggest personalized recommendations and investigate alternative treatment solutions.
